The Return on Reentry: What Actually Works

In this episode of The ROC Podcast, Arkansas Director Wil Cheatham joins Britt Allen to discuss what’s working in reentry—and where policy can do more. Drawing from Wil’s visits to reentry facilities across the state, they explore how different models, from faith-based to workforce-focused, are helping individuals successfully transition back into society. The conversation highlights the importance of structure, employment, and family stability in reducing recidivism, while also addressing persistent barriers like fines, fees, and access to basic documentation.

Inside Idaho’s Women’s Incarceration Crisis with Rep. Chris Mathias

In this episode of the Right On Crime Podcast, Idaho State Director Molly Lenty sits down with Idaho State Rep. Chris Mathias for a wide-ranging conversation on women’s incarceration and criminal justice policy in their state. They discuss key drivers behind incarceration trends, including the role of technical violations of supervision, the impact of domestic and sexual violence on women, and how other states like Oklahoma and Georgia are pursuing solutions that allow judges to consider the full context of a case at sentencing. Their conversation also explores the importance of effective reentry programming, family stability, and supervision systems that promote accountability while supporting successful reintegration into the community.
